How to Get More Pet Sitting & Dog Walking Customers

Starting a pet sitting or dog walking business is exciting, but one of the biggest questions new business owners ask is:

"How do I find customers?"

The good news is that there are many ways to attract new clients and build a successful pet care business. The most successful pet sitters and dog walkers don't rely on just one source of work — they use a combination of marketing methods to create a steady flow of enquiries.

Look Professional From Day One

Before spending money on advertising, it's important to create a professional image.

Potential clients are trusting you with their pets and often the keys to their home. They want reassurance that you are reliable, trustworthy, and committed to your business.

Create Social Media Pages

Social media can be one of the most effective ways to attract local customers.

Consider creating:

  • Facebook Business Page
  • Instagram Account
  • TikTok Account
  • Google Business Profile

Share:

  • Dog walks
  • Pet sitting visits
  • Customer testimonials
  • Pet care tips
  • Behind-the-scenes content
  • Seasonal advice

Consistent posting helps build trust and keeps your business visible within your local community.

Set Up a Google Business Profile

A Google Business Profile allows your business to appear in local Google searches and on Google Maps.

This can generate valuable enquiries from local pet owners searching for:

  • Dog walker near me
  • Pet sitter near me
  • Home dog boarding near me

Encourage happy customers to leave reviews as these can significantly increase enquiries.

Ask for Reviews and Testimonials

Word-of-mouth remains one of the most powerful marketing tools available.

After completing a booking, ask satisfied clients to leave a review.

Positive reviews can be displayed on:

  • Your NarpsUK profile
  • Google Business Profile
  • Facebook page
  • Website

Reviews provide social proof and help potential clients feel confident about choosing your services.

Use Flyers and Business Cards

Traditional marketing still works well in many areas.

Consider distributing flyers and business cards to:

  • Veterinary practices
  • Pet shops
  • Groomers
  • Training clubs
  • Community noticeboards
  • Local businesses

Ensure your marketing materials include your NarpsUK membership logos, qualifications, insurance details, and contact information.

Network With Other Pet Professionals

Building relationships with other pet professionals can generate referrals.

Useful contacts include:

  • Dog groomers
  • Veterinary practices
  • Dog trainers
  • Pet shops
  • Behaviourists
  • Rescue centres

These businesses often receive enquiries from pet owners looking for services they do not provide.

Encourage Recommendations

Happy customers are often your best source of future business.

Consider introducing a referral scheme where existing clients receive a small discount or free service when they recommend a new customer.

Be Reliable and Consistent

The best marketing strategy of all is providing an excellent service.

Clients who trust you are more likely to:

  • Rebook regularly
  • Recommend you to friends and family
  • Leave positive reviews
  • Become long-term customers

Many successful pet sitters and dog walkers build their businesses almost entirely through recommendations.
